Did you follow these instructions? (It doesn’t seem like it?)
It’s a pretty good bet, but make sure that you’ve got stuff like in the multisite install topic.
If your sites are working now then I too would encourage you to do a clean multisite install and backup/restore the databases over. You can copy all the other stuff as described in Move a Discourse site to another VPS with rsync